Most attic fans operate with a thermostat that automatically turns the fan on and off based on a temperature the homeowner sets.
Roof fan thermostat setting.
This temperature can be anywhere between 80 to 120 degree fahrenheit.
Most manufacturers and contractors recommend a temperature setting between 100 and 110 degrees fahrenheit.
